Donna Tartt is an American author who has achieved critical and public acclaim for her novels, which have been published in forty languages. Her first novel, The Secret History, was published in 1992. In 2003 she received the WH Smith Literary Award for her novel, The Little Friend, which was also nominated for the Orange Prize for Fiction. The Secret History Donna Tartt Study Guide Jump to: Summary Characters Literary Devices Quotes Buy Now Donna Tartt's first novel, The Secret History, contains elements of mystery and of the psychological fiction genre. It was published in 1992.
